What is Thymalin & CAS 63958-64-9?
In the specialized field of immunogerontology, Thymalin (also known as Thymulin) is recognized as a nonapeptide hormone originally isolated from the thymus gland. Identified by CAS 63958-64-9, this bioregulator is unique because its biological activity is strictly dependent on the presence of the metal zinc, forming a zinc-peptide complex. It is engineered for research into the restoration of the immune system’s primary defense mechanisms. Researchers utilize Thymalin to investigate the biological triggers for T-lymphocyte maturation and the reversal of thymic involution, which is a hallmark of the aging process.

Thymalin (Thymulin) Mechanism of Action and Research
Regarding the specific pathways of immunological recovery, Thymalin functions by binding to specific receptors on T-lymphocytes, stimulating their differentiation and enhancing their functional activity. In a laboratory environment, scientists observe that Thymalin facilitates the production of various cytokines and modulates the neuroendocrine-immune axis. By leveraging these properties, Thymalin research focuses on its ability to normalize the ratio of T-helper cells to T-suppressor cells, thereby stabilizing the body’s adaptive immune response during chronic stress or biological decline.
Advancing the understanding of systemic cellular repair, contemporary studies utilize Thymalin to evaluate its impact on the inflammatory microenvironment. Emerging data from high-fidelity laboratory trials suggests that Thymalin can influence the circadian rhythms of the immune system and promote the repair of lymphoid tissues. Its multifaceted role in balancing the hormonal output of the thymus makes it a foundational pillar for research into longevity, chronic recovery signaling, and the biological optimization of the immune defense.

Thymalin (Thymulin) FAQ
How does Thymalin influence the immune system in laboratory models?
Scientists investigate Thymalin for its ability to act as a “signal” for the maturation of T-cells. In research settings, it is observed to normalize the activity of the immune system by influencing the thymus gland, potentially reversing the decline in immune surveillance typically associated with aging or chronic physiological stress.

What is the recommended reconstitution protocol for Thymalin 10mg?
To achieve reproducible data, Thymalin should be reconstituted with sterile bacteriostatic water. The liquid should be introduced slowly down the side of the vial. Use a gentle swirling motion; do not shake the vial, as mechanical stress can denature the delicate nonapeptide structure and compromise research results.
Does Thymalin require zinc for its biological research activity?
In various research models, the biological activity of Thymalin (Thymulin) is enhanced when complexed with zinc. Researchers often study the synergy between the peptide and zinc ions to observe the stabilization of its active conformation and its binding affinity to T-cell receptors.
